A Better Way for BPA is a WA State Non-Profit Corporation. We are an organized group of rural landowners encompassing Clark and Cowlitz counties. We chose to live away from infrastructure. We like electricity. We are not against Bonneville Power Administration. However, we are against BPA creating a new transmission corridor for their I-5 Corridor Reinforcement Project. We say BPA should run their 500 kV transmission lines on their own land along routes 9 and 25 where they planned for expansion 70 years ago.

At a time when our nation and it's citizens are struggling financially, it would be fiscally irresponsible for Bonneville Power Administration to build a new, more expensive corridor when they can build on the land they already own rights to.
|
West Alternative |
Crossover Alternative |
Central Alternative |
East Alternative |
Private Acres |
94 acres |
492 acres |
873 acres |
1055 acres |
Total Acres |
122 acres |
783 acres |
1291 acres |
1273 acres |
Cost in Millions |
317 Million |
363 Million |
407 Million |
406 Million |
